Management Commentary

Management comments accompanying the the previous quarter earnings release centered on the firm’s core operational priorities during the quarter, including targeted investments to upgrade aging distribution infrastructure, reduce system water loss rates, and expand service access to under-resourced communities in its operating footprint. Leadership noted that regulatory rate review outcomes in several key operating states during the quarter supported balanced cost recovery structures, which could help limit volatility in operating performance moving forward. Management also referenced operational efficiency initiatives rolled out across multiple service regions as a contributing factor to the reported the previous quarter EPS performance, though specific details on cost savings or granular operational metrics were not included in the initial release. No references to quarterly revenue performance were included in published management commentary, in line with the limited financial data shared in the initial earnings announcement. Forward Guidance

Forward-looking statements shared alongside the the previous quarter earnings focused on high-level operational priorities rather than specific quantitative financial targets, in line with the limited scope of the initial release. Management noted that planned capital expenditure programs, aligned with both regulatory mandates and long-term service quality goals, would remain a core focus in upcoming operational periods. Leadership also highlighted potential external factors that could impact future performance, including ongoing rate case proceedings across multiple operating jurisdictions, fluctuating raw material costs for infrastructure projects, and potential access to federal and state grant programs designed to support water system upgrades. Management advised that full quantitative guidance, including details on projected capital spending and operational metrics, would be shared during the upcoming the previous quarter earnings conference call with analysts and investors. Market Reaction

In trading sessions immediately following the the previous quarter earnings release, AWK’s share price saw limited movement on roughly average trading volume, as market participants digested the limited initial financial disclosures. Sector analysts have noted that the reported the previous quarter EPS figure falls within the range of broad market expectations published ahead of the release, though most analysts have deferred deeper commentary on the firm’s performance until full financial statements, including revenue data, are publicly available. The muted market reaction also aligns with broader recent trends in the regulated utility sector, as investors weigh the defensive characteristics of utility assets against evolving macroeconomic factors including interest rate trajectory expectations. Some market participants have noted that the absence of revenue data in the initial release may lead to temporary price volatility as additional details emerge in the coming weeks.
